Call Of Duty: Black Ops 6 Launches With DLC To Support Military Veterans


S.E. Doster
10/22/2024

Call of Duty: Black Ops 6 arrives on October 25, and it will launch with a new DLC that supports charity. The in-game store will include the Call of Duty Endowment Endeavour: Tracer Pack, with all proceeds supporting military veterans.Similar to previous Call of Duty Endowment bundles, all proceeds from the Endeavour: Tracer Pack go to Activision Blizzard's Call of Duty Endowment, which is a charity that helps US and UK military veterans find new civilian jobs after leaving the service.The bundle includes the Endowment's first-ever U.K. operator skin called "SC1," as well as two unique weapon blueprints.
